Energy Energy is one important way many of the things

we see and interact with every day are connected, and sometimes one of the hardest to see.

Energy-based definitions:

Source – something that releases energy and is the source for energy producers

Producer – something that uses the energy from a source to create a new form of energy that is usable by many consumers

Consumer – something that uses this converted energy in order to function. Can be at different levels

Interdependency Key idea – energy was an example

Many different parts of a system depend on each other in more than one way

When even one connection is lost, a system can fail

Simplicity Simplicity is used to single out an

item or items from their surrounding for particular emphasis.

Page 6: Sustainability Photography: Thinking Through the Lens –

Framing Framing is used to bring the focus

of the image to the desired subject. Adds depth and perspective to image.
